Shocks and Struts
You know if you need new shocks or struts if you notice any of the following:
- Wear on your shocks and struts: use your judgement to determine if the wear on your shocks is severe enough to cause damage.
- Leaking from your shocks and struts: look for oil or general wetness on the outside of the shock or strut
- Damage to your shocks and struts: check for a broken mount or dented housing.
- Your vehicle fails a "bounce test": Does your vehicle bounce excessively after hitting a bump or driving on rough roads? Does the nose of your vehicle dip when you hit the brakes? Does your vehicle sway excessively when driving in the crosswinds?
While you don't have to replace your shocks at a certain mileage like you would your spark plugs, or oil, but shocks and struts do wear out over time and need to be replaced.
